Back button in Setup

Submitted by Ensign Joe on January 21, 2009 to Aesthetics

If you entered all the information neccessary and setup begins copying and expanding its files there is no back button in the titlebar. After Windows restarted and Windows is finalizing the installation there is a back button in the titlebar but it is - logically - disabled.

Either remove the back button on the finalizing screen or add a disabled back button to the copy process.
